Age Concern Epsom & Ewell

Telephone:

01372 728 758
Criteria for eligibility:

Elderly. Must be resident in Epsom & Ewell
Transport provided for:

Only for medical appointments

Areas covered:

Mostly borough of Epsom & Ewell, some journeys to outside borough hospitals

Vehicles:

Volunteer drivers own cars (unable to carry wheelchairs)
Booking procedure:

Ideally one weeks notice required. telephone above number Mon to Fri 0930 to 1300
Charges/donations:

£3.50 return within the borough of Epsom & Ewell, special rates for other journeys.
Hours of operation:

Monday to Friday 0800-1800. Occasionally a Saturday appointments can be covered
Any other details:

Carers can accompany clients at no extra cost. Drivers will wait for up to an hour to take a clients home. For longer appointments asecond driver must be booked.

Also provide a home visiting service, foot care, hearing aid clinics, Sunday teas and give information and advice.

Route Call Dial-a-Ride

Telephone:

01372 732 000
Criteria for eligibility:

Residents of the borough of Epsom & Ewell who are aged 60 and over or have difficulty using public transport or are mobility impaired
Areas covered:

Anywhere within the Borough of Epsom & Ewell. Medical centres and nursing homes on the borough borders. Hospitals outside the borough as follows: Ashtead, Leatherhead, Royal Marsden(Sutton), St. Anthony's, St. Helier and Sutton Eye
Vehicles:

8 minibuses with seating capacity for up to 14 passengers. All vehicles are adapted to carry wheelchair users
Booking procedure:

Telephone Monday to Friday 0830-1700. Bookings can be made up to 3 weeks in advance. Next day trips must be booked by 1400 on the day before.
Charges/donations:

Annual membership fee £10.50. Fares vary depending on the type of journey undertaken i.e. Dial-a-Ride (appointments), Dial-a-Bus (shopping) and day centre transport. Details available at time of making a booking
Hours of operation:

Monday to Friday 0845 to 1645, Saturday (shopping only) 0845 to 1600
Any other details:

Excursions to places of interest, pub lunches, coastal trips etc are organised for Thursday afternoons and weekends
